    Function:  Assist the Internal Auditor in conducting reviews of organizational and functional activities in accordance with Board policies and procedures and according to the board approved internal audit plan

    Reports To:  Internal Auditor

    Responsibilities:
    • Assist the Internal Auditor in conducting audits in a professional manner in accordance with the established audit program and the approved audit plan
    • Obtain, analyze, and appraise evidential data as a basis for an informed, objective opinion on the adequency and effectiveness of the controls being tested and the efficiency and reliability of the activities being reviewed
    • Inform the Internal Auditor of any issues that arise in the course of the audit in a timely manner
    • Prepare detailed work papers to document audits performed and reports issued
    • Assist in preparing formal written reports expressing an overall opinion on the function being reviewed and provide constructive recommendations to improve controls designed to safeguard District resources to ensure compliance with applicable laws and regulations
    • Assist in conducting follow-up reviews of recommendations implemented
    • Perform other duties as assigned
